Applications are now open for the 2024 McKinsey & Company Next Generation Women Leaders Program EMEA. The Next Generation Women Leaders (NGWL) EMEA program is a three-day virtual program taking place April 25-27, 2024. Attendees will explore the importance of women in leadership, develop their own leadership abilities, and create a long-lasting community.

Benefits

Learning sessions

Program participants will be invited to learning sessions hosted by our colleagues, addressing important topics around communication and impact.

Local networking events

Following the three-day event in April, program participants will be invited to local meetups where they can connect with our colleagues and network with other NGWL attendees.

Interview preparation program

All participants who are interested in learning more about McKinsey’s recruiting process will be invited to an interview-preparation program. Those in attendance will learn about our case and personal-experience interviews, join Q&A sessions, and practice cases in small groups.

Agenda: April 25-27

  • Next Generation Women Leaders EMEA will begin the evening of Thursday, April 25 with welcome words, an opportunity to ask questions, and ample time to get to know one another in an informal virtual setting.

  • Throughout the next two days, attendees
    will participate in interactive workshops, hear from inspirational McKinsey speakers, and work with facilitators to further shape their leadership style.

  • During the program, attendees will enhance their leadership skills, and focus on personal and professional development – in particular, confidence and effective communication skills.

  • The program will continue with learning workshops and informative virtual sessions throughout May and June.

    Application Requirements

    To be considered for NGWL EMEA, you must be currently based in or have strong ties to Europe, the Middle East, or Africa. You must also be:

  • A bachelor’s, master’s, PhD, or MBA student graduating no later than 2026.

  • A professional with up to eight years of work experience.
